The Senator representing Kaduna South Senatorial District in the National Assembly, Senator Sunday Marshall Katung, has facilitated the training of over 200 people on ICT profit maximization.

The gesture is part of Senator Katung’s desire to improve the economic well-being of his constituents at the grassroots level.

According to Senator Katung, the move is aimed at providing the necessary skills for people in rural communities to thrive economically using smartphones.

Senator Katung who spoke through his Senior Legislative Aide, Hon. Wilson Iliya, at the venue of the three days training program in Kubacha, Kagarko Local Government Area of Kaduna State, said the skill acquisition training is meant to address the growing issue of unemployment, especially at the grassroots level.

Senator Katung noted that the training, which brought together men and women from Kagarko Local Government Area, will enable beneficiaries to leverage on technology for business growth, e-commerce, and digital marketing through the usage of their handsets.

“I intend to expose our citizens at the grassroots to the use of their smartphones to create wealth for themselves. Our citizens at the local level will have skills to thrive in today’s technology-driven world,” he said.

Also speaking at the event, a Senior Manager at the Nigerian Communications Satellite Limited (NICOMSAT), Mr Obamde Sunny Jack, said the training was designed to teach people at the grassroots how to make use of their handsets to turn around their fortunes.

“We are here in partnership with Senator Katung to train the people at the grassroots on the use of smartphones to create legal wealth for themselves.

“The handsets are not just for calls alone, they can be used for wealth creation through digital marketing within the comfort of their homes. Generally, the idea is to reduce poverty.

“The world has gone global, and we must train our people to acquaint themselves with technology as the fastest means of making money, legally,” he said.

The training was in partnership with the Nigerian Communications Satellite Limited (NICOMSAT).
